Pros
- Seven-minute walk to the A and C subway into Manhattan
- Chic, minimalist rooms with modern slate-tile bathrooms
- Free breakfast with pastries and bagels from a local bakery
- Free parking in a private lot
- Free Wi-Fi throughout
- 24/7 front-desk attendant
Cons
- Safety concerns in the neighborhood
- Removed from Manhattan attractions
- Rooms can be noisy
Bottom Line
Opened in December 2013, Hotel Luxe is a boutique property located on Atlantic Avenue in Brooklyn, a seven-minute walk to the subway into Manhattan. The rooms are stylish and minimalist and the bathrooms, while small, are clean and modern. The hotel offers affordable rates in an otherwise expensive city and is a good option for the budget traveller who doesn’t mind a subway ride to most attractions. However, the neighborhood does have higher crime rates than others in Brooklyn and the rooms can be noisy from train traffic outside and thin interior walls. Hotel Le Bleu, in nearby Park Slope, is also affordable and in a slightly nicer area.

Scene
Modern, reasonably priced property with stylish decor
The Hotel Luxe is a newer property, and it shows in the style and decor throughout the public spaces. The lobby -- while small -- is chic and stylish, with a large leather couch, two patterned chairs, a black coffee table, and a built-in electric fireplace. The hallways have wood floors and all signage is brown with a light blue matte border. There aren’t many common areas in the hotel besides the lobby and the breakfast room. The property attracts a mix of travelers, including international tourists and business travelers who need easy access to the reasonably nearby Barclays Center.
Location
A short subway ride to Brooklyn attractions, but far from Manhattan sightseeing
The Hotel Luxe is located between the Crown Heights and Bedford Stuyvesant neighborhoods. While not necessarily unsafe, the neighborhood is certainly evolving and can appear a little rough. Crime rates in Bedford Stuyvesant to the north are still among the highest in New York City. The hotel is on an unattractive, industrial stretch of Atlantic Avenue, filled with car lots and repair shops. However, there are convenience stores and restaurants short walk away. The A and C lines of the subway are a seven-minute walk from the hotel. The Barclay’s Center and Atlantic Terminal shopping are a nine-minute ride by bus, 18-minute subway ride, or 40-minute walk. It is a 20-minute subway into downtown Manhattan and a 40-minute ride into Midtown. The new boro (green) taxis make taking cabs easier to and from Manhattan, and they are getting more prevalent around Brooklyn neighborhoods. It's a 25-minute subway ride, or 30-minute walk to both Prospect Park and the Brooklyn Botanic Garden. Washington Square Park takes half an hour to reach on the subway while Times Square takes 40 minutes. JFK and LaGuardia are each a 30-minute drive away.
Rooms
Modern, stylish rooms with chic bathrooms
Rooms are spacious and modern, with hardwood floors, red accent walls, modern white bedding, and light-wood furnishings. Prints of iconic New York scenery of bridges and buildings hang on the walls. All rooms have flat-screen TVs, coffeemakers, and free Wi-Fi. Some rooms also have safes. The bathrooms are small but chic, modern, and well-lit, with white vanities and gray slate on the walls and in the walk-in showers. The hotel is located directly across the street from the railroad tracks, so the rooms get a good amount of train traffic noise (the train runs once or twice an hour during the day and occasionally at night). Past guests have also complained of noise from other rooms.
Features
Free continental breakfast, free Wi-Fi, and free on-site parking
Hotel Luxe's limited amenities include a free continental breakfast served in a small room on the bottom floor. Items include juice, cereal, oatmeal, fruit, and coffee, as well as bagels, donuts, and other pastries from a local bakery. There is ample free parking in a safe, private lot located behind the hotel. There is no business center but the front desk provides printing and faxing services free of charge and Wi-Fi is free throughout the hotel.
